3. CITIZEN COMMENTS
At this time, three (3) minute comments will be taken from the audience on any topic.
Anyone in attendance wishing to address the Board/Commission must complete a citizen
comment form and give the completed form to the Board/Commission Secretary prior to
the start of the Board/Commission meeting. In accordance with the Texas Open Meetings
Act, if a citizen discusses any item not on the agenda, the Board/Commission cannot
discuss issues raised or make any decision at this time. Instead, the Board/Commission
is limited to making a statement of specific factual information or a recitation of existing
policy in response to the inquiry. Issues may be referred to City Manager for research and
possible future action.
It is not the intention of the City of Bastrop to provide a public forum for the embarrassment
or demeaning of any individual or group. Neither is it the intention of the
Board/Commission to allow a member of the public to slur the performance, honesty
and/or integrity of the Board/Commission, as a body, or any member or members of the
Board/Commission individually or collectively, or members of the City’s staff. Accordingly,
profane, insulting or threatening language directed toward the Board/Commission and/or
any person in the Board/Commission’s presence will not be tolerated.
